Overview We are at a defining moment for Microsoft to lead the market in helping small and medium enterprise (SME) customers accelerate their Frontier transformation—leveraging our differentiated portfolio and global partner ecosystem. The Director, GS&O Communications role sits within the SME&C Global Strategy & Operations (GS&O) Executive Office and reports directly to the Chief of Staff.

This role is responsible for shaping and driving the mid- and long-term strategic narrative, while building an integrated communication strategy that connects all channels into a cohesive, high-impact storytelling engine. This leader will translate business strategy into clear narratives, ensure consistency across executive, field, and partner communications.

This role requires a balance of strategic thinking, storytelling excellence, and cross-org orchestration. Responsibilities Strategic Narrative Leadership This role requires a strategic communications leader to help frame our Go-to-Market (GTM) strategy in market, with high empathy for a field sales audience to help translate strategy into highly impactful communications and connected workstreams.

Translate complex business strategy into clear, compelling, and differentiated storytelling for internal and external audiences Understands, segments, and targets audience needs and adapts communications strategies accordingly (e.g. executive messaging, field communications, partner engagement, and external storytelling).

Integrated Communication Strategy Develop and drive a comprehensive SME&C GS&O communication strategy that connects executive messaging, field communications, partner engagement, and external storytelling Ensure consistency of voice, message hierarchy, and narrative across all channels and touchpoints Recommend and operationalize the most effective channels and formats for different audiences and priorities Executive & Leadership Communications Partner closely with senior leadership to shape key messages, presentations, and communication moments Translate business priorities into clear executive-level messaging that drives alignment and action across the organization Support key forums (e.g., leadership meetings, global events, major announcements) with strong narrative coherence Cross-Org Orchestration Drive alignment across marketing, sales, partner, and field teams to ensure a unified story Collaborate with global and regional teams to scale narratives effectively while allowing for local relevance Serve as a central connector across stakeholders to drive execution of strategic communications initiatives Storytelling & Content Development Lead development of high-impact narratives, messaging frameworks, and core content assets Guide storytelling across campaigns, executive platforms, and internal communications to reinforce strategic priorities Ensure all communications connect back to business outcomes and reinforce Microsoft’s differentiation Measurement & Optimization Define success metrics and track effectiveness of communication strategies Use insights and feedback to continuously refine narratives, channels, and tactics Ensure communications efforts are data-driven and aligned to business impact Qualifications Required/minimum qualifications Bachelor's Degree in Business, Business Administration, Marketing, Communications, Finance, or related field AND 6+ years communications, marketing operations, field operations, program management, project management, or related experience OR equivalent experience Additional or preferred qualifications 6+ years experience supporting senior executives in an executive communications role 4+ years experience in technology, AI, cloud, or partner ecosystems Knowledge of small medium business market dynamics Effective storytelling and narrative-building capabilities with the ability to influence across complex, matrixed organizations Experience working with or advising senior executives Communications IC5 - The typical base pay range for this role across the U.S. is USD $130,900 - $251,900 per year.

There is a different range applicable to specific work locations, within the San Francisco Bay area and New York City metropolitan area, and the base pay range for this role in those locations is USD $165,600 - $272,300 per year. Certain roles may be eligible for benefits and other compensation.
